Finding a list of the burned books is not easy.
quote:

The books included Tintin in America (for depicting Indigenous people in a negative light), books that contained ‘cultural appropriation’, and biographies of French explorers who discovered parts of what is now known as Canada. The flame-purification ceremony was, according to the school board, about making a ‘gesture of openness and reconciliation by replacing books in our libraries that had outdated content… about First Nations, Métis and Inuit people’.


LINK

Among the titles were "Tintin in America," "Asterix and the Indians" and three Lucky Luke comic books, as well as novels and encyclopedias.


LINK

But there's more to the story.

The woman behind the making of the list ISN'T a real Indian according to THE LIST established in Canada.

“We firmly believed Kies' claims to be an Indigenous woman from the Wbanaki Confederacy and the Turtle Clan.

We were not aware that Suzy Kies does not have Indian status under the act and sincerely believed that we had the opportunity to work with an experienced Indigenous knowledge keeper,” Cosette said.
